A surveying crew has the job of measuring a mountain. From a point on the ground they measure an angle of elevation of 21.6 degrees to the top. They move 507 m closer to the mountain and find that the angle of elevation is now 35.8 degrees. How high is the mountain? (You may have to calculate some other things along the way.)
The mountain is 445.1 m high.

Hannah works for a construction company that is planning to build a bridge from the mainland to an island. There are two options to start the bridge from, point X and point Y, which are 1000 m apart. From point X to the island she measures a 42 degree angle, and from point Y she measures a 58 degree angle. In order to decide she must know the precise lengths of the two possible bridges and choose the shorter of the two to save costs. a.What are the precise lengths of the two bridges? b. If constructing the bridge costs $370 per meter, how much could be saved by building the shorter one?
a. x= 679.453m y= 861. 131m b. $67, 220.70 saved

You can use the Law of Sines to find an unknown angle measure, but this technique is risky. Suppose triangle ABC has sides of 4 cm, 7 cm and 10 cm. a. Use law of cosines to find the measure of angle A. b. Use the answer to part a (don't round) and the law of sines to find the measure of angle C.
a. A= 33.1229 degrees b. C= 51.318 degrees
